Holistic therapy looks at the whole person, not just their symptoms or problems. It aims to improve overall quality of life by addressing multiple areas simultaneously. This approach recognises that different aspects of our lives are interconnected, and improving one area can positively impact others.
Here are some signs that you are receiving holistic therapy:
Personalised Care Plans: Your unique needs and circumstances are considered, and care plans are tailored specifically for you.
Multidisciplinary Approach: Professionals from various fields collaborate to provide comprehensive care.
Focus on Prevention and Wellness: Emphasis on preventive measures and promoting overall wellness, not just treating existing issues.
Emotional and Social Support: Recognising the importance of emotional and social well-being in addition to physical health.
Accessibility and Convenience: Services are accessible and convenient, making it easier for you to receive the care you need.

Here are some examples of how our occupational therapy can help:
Rehabilitation for Physical Injuries:
Example: An occupational therapist can assist an individual recovering from a stroke by providing exercises to improve motor skills and coordination, helping them regain the ability to perform daily tasks such as dressing and eating independently.
Example: Assisting a person with a spinal cord injury in adapting their home environment with assistive devices and teaching them strategies to perform daily activities, promoting independence and safety.
Enhancing Cognitive Skills:
Example: An occupational therapist can work with individuals with cognitive impairments, such as memory loss or difficulty concentrating, by using cognitive training exercises and memory aids to improve their cognitive function and daily living skills.
Example: Providing interventions for children with developmental delays to improve their attention, problem-solving skills, and ability to follow instructions through engaging and structured activities.

Here are some examples of how our psychosocial support services can help:
Counselling and Therapy:
Example: Offering individual or group counselling sessions to help individuals cope with stress, anxiety, or depression, providing a safe space to discuss their feelings and develop coping strategies.
Example: Providing family therapy to address interpersonal issues and improve communication and relationships within the family unit, fostering a supportive environment for the individual.
Peer Support Programmes:
Example: Establishing peer support groups where individuals can share experiences, offer mutual support, and gain insights from others facing similar challenges, enhancing their sense of community and belonging.
Example: Training peer support workers who have lived experience with mental health issues to provide guidance, support, and advocacy for others on their recovery journey.
